Braintree Drop-off Centers
Robert Salvaggio Drop-Off Center of Braintree
Bob Salvaggio was a dedicated and committed resident of Braintree. He was a founding member of the Recycling Committee and Chairman for many years. Bob championed many recycling initiatives and helped Braintree become a leader in community recycling. To commemorate his civic pride and tireless work ethic, the Ivory Street Drop Off Center was renamed the Robert Salvaggio Drop-Off Center of Braintree in the Summer of 2007.

Recycling Acceptable Materials (Trash Sticker not Required)
Newspapers, including inserts, paper bags, paperback books, phone books, magazines, junk mail, brochures, catalogues, office paper, all envelopes, file and hanging folders, post it notes, cereal boxes, shoe boxes, pasta & cracker boxes, etc. with liners removed, cardboard, milk and juice cartons, books with hard covers removed, glass bottles & jars, aluminum foil and food containers(cleaned), tin and steel cans, all plastics 1-7. No plastic bags are accepted, please return them to containers inside every supermarket-bring to any market, no matter where they come from. Drop-off is also single stream so materials do not have to be separated. All go in the same red container at the Center.

Covanta, Small Project Remodeling Disposal
Residents with small "do it yourself" projects can now bring construction material to the scale house of the Covanta Transfer Station and pay just 10 cents a point for disposal. Payment is by credit card only. Simply state you are a Braintree resident and show proof of residency. (Covanta Station 781-843-6209). Hours listed above.
